A Plumber Can Evaluate the Supply Lines
A supply line, especially a dish washer port, connects the dish washer to a water source. If you buy a brand-new supply line, a plumber can make certain that the line is compatible with both your dishwashing machine and water source. An expert plumber can evaluate it to ensure that it's in excellent problem and also does not have any leakages if you choose to make use of an existing supply line.

Setting Up a Dishwashing Machine Needs a Variety of Tools
You may need to make a trip to Lowe's or Home Depot if you do not have a selection of tools on hand. To install a dishwasher, you need the following tools: pliers, an adjustable wrench, a collection of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and hole saws. You will certainly additionally need cleansing supplies such as a superficial pail as well as sponge. If you do not have any one of these items, the cost to buy them can build up swiftly.
Not Installing Your Dish Washer Correctly Can Cause a Hill of Problems
Not just can setting up a dish washer appropriately invalidate your service warranty, however it can also develop a mess. If you do not mount the supply line appropriately, you might deal with leaks-- or also worse, a flooding. You might additionally exper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s as well rapidly via your pipelines as well as causes loud trembling sounds. If you improperly install your dish washer to the waste disposal, you might notice poignant scents or have deposit on your dishes.

PLUMBING SERVICES YOU'LL NEED FOR A KITCHEN REMODEL
S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
